Solar Energy Analysis for 52601

Solar Radiation Data in 52601

Based on historical 52601 data, solar panels that are tilted towards the equator at an angle equal to the latitude will produce the maximum solar energy output in 52601. [1]

The region associated with 52601 has an average monthly Global Horizontal Irradiance (GHI) of 4.01 kilowatt hours per square meter per day (kWh/m2/day), which is approximately 2% less than the average monthly Direct Normal Irradiance (DNI) of 4.08 kWh/m2/day. [1]

Solar installations in 52601 that are always titled at the latitude of Burlington (Average Tilt at Latitude or ATaL) average 4.68 kWh/m2/day, or about 17% greater than the average monthly GHI of 4.01 kWh/m2/day and approximately 15% greater than the average monthly DNI of 4.08 kWh/m2/day. [1]

Solar Energy Glossary

Global Horizontal Irradiance (GHI)

Global Horizontal Irradiance: The total amount of solar radiation that is received per unit area by a surface that is always positioned in a horizontal manner.

Direct Normal Irradiance (DNI)

Direct Normal Irradiance: The total amount of solar radiation received per unit area by a surface that is always perpendicular to the sun rays that come in a straight line from the direction of the sun at its current position in the sky.

Average Tilt at Latitude (ATaL)

Average Tilt at Latitude: The total amount of solar radiation received per unit area by a surface that is tilted toward the equator at an angle equal to the current latitude. ATaL will often produce the optimum energy output.

Solar Radiation Analysis for 52601

Solar Radiation Data in 52601

The region associated with 52601 has a average annual solar radiation value of 4.95 kilowatt hours per square meter per day (kWh/m2/day). [1]

The month with the highest historical solar radition values in 52601 is June with an average of 6.02 kWh/m2/day, followed by July at 6.02 kWh/m2/day and August at 6 kWh/m2/day. [1]

The three months that historically average the lowest average solar radiation levels in 52601 are December with an average of 3.03 kWh/m2/day, followed by January with an average of 3.71 kWh/m2/day and November at 3.74 kWh/m2/day. [1]

Solar Output Analysis for 52601

Solar Radiation Data in 52601

52601 has a average annual solar AC output value of 5657.7 kilowatt hours (AC). [2]

The month with the highest historical solar power output in 52601 is August with an average of 554.06 kWhac, followed by July at 547.62 kWhac and June at 545.33 kWhac. [2]

The three months that historically average the lowest average solar output levels in 52601 are December with an average of 314.48 kWhac, followed by November with an average of 366.06 kWhac and January at 387.08 kWhac. [2]
